Address 92.80103043 DCR

Dshcua5qjQkK76w3XCLfmkh2uXu2EdFdhqC

Confirmed

Total Received92.80103043 DCR
Total Sent0 DCR
Final Balance92.80103043 DCR
No. Transactions1

Transactions

DsZoTUmrdysHfnMRjfkT5q16bbR6wwrw4sP85.92001589 DCR
No Inputs (Newly Generated Coins)
Dshcua5qjQkK76w3XCLfmkh2uXu2EdFdhqC92.80103043 DCR ×
Dsetdq34MHXHQRWss1ZqPKJr8Y39azvqJWq82.47957367 DCR
Fee: 0 DCR
615022 Confirmations175.2806041 DCR